Is it better to use a mortgage broker or a bank?

In my experience, whether it's better to use a mortgage broker or a bank depends largely on your individual needs and circumstances. Banks can offer direct access to their products, which might be advantageous if you have a strong relationship with your bank and they're offering competitive rates. However, a mortgage broker, like myself, can provide a wider range of options from various lenders, including banks, credit unions, and other financial institutions. This means we can often find more competitive rates or products better tailored to unique financial situations. For instance, if you're self-employed, I can help find lenders who are more understanding of your income structure. The choice really comes down to whether you prefer the convenience and potential loyalty benefits of a single institution or the broader access and personalized comparison shopping that comes with a broker.

Is it worth paying a mortgage broker?

Yes, in many instances, it is worth paying a mortgage broker for several reasons. First, mortgage brokers have access to a wide range of products and can help you find a mortgage solution that fits your specific needs, which can save you a significant amount of money over the life of your mortgage. Additionally, we navigate the application process on your behalf, saving you time and reducing the stress associated with securing a mortgage. Our expertise and guidance can also be invaluable in understanding the complexities of different mortgage options. It's important to remember that in many cases, the lender, not you, pays the broker's fee, meaning you can gain access to all this expertise without any direct cost to you.

How much do mortgage brokers charge in Canada?

In Canada, mortgage broker fees can vary, but in many cases, the client does not directly pay for the broker's services. Instead, brokers are compensated by the lenders they place the mortgage with. This commission is usually a percentage of the loan amount, ranging from about 0.5% to 1.2%. This structure aligns our interests with yours because it means we are incentivized to find you the best mortgage solution. However, in more complex situations, such as when working with clients who have poor credit or require specialized lending solutions, brokers may charge a fee directly to the client. In these cases, fees should be discussed upfront and clearly outlined.
